Output efa5dfe95d7f44bfbbf3b6a661d2601a6e54c24eef8ecd076013b35b38f5d040:3

value
22181101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1afd56ba818ff3e86c545a11c1e8aa43d8fef488 OP_EQUAL
address
349iypS2aPuyuuumcYm3cRjANNo7CscQAb
transaction
efa5dfe95d7f44bfbbf3b6a661d2601a6e54c24eef8ecd076013b35b38f5d040
spent
true